Abstract

In a hydrodesulfurization process having separate naphtha and distillate hydrodesulfurization zones, volatile fractions of the distillate hydrodesulfurization effluent are recycled to the naphtha feed stream before it combines with the hydrogen stream and enters the hydrodesulfurization zone and heavy fractions separated from the naphtha hydrodesulfurization effluent are combined with a diesel fuel oil fraction separated from the distillate hydrodesulfurization effluent. Alternatively, light fractions separated from the distillate hydrodesulfurization effluent are combined with a condensed liquid stream being returned to a distillation fractionation zone separating light fractions from the naphtha hydrodesulfurization effluent.
